Article Overview

This article reviews selected changes in the latest National Correct Coding Initiative (CCI) update that affect gastrointestinal coding. It focuses on newly bundled procedure combinations, changes to modifier bypass eligibility, and the impact of those edits on reporting decisions for GI physicians and coding professionals.

Why This Topic Matters

CCI edits can change whether services may be reported together or whether a modifier is permitted, which directly affects claim accuracy and compliance. This update helps coding staff identify which GI procedure combinations are newly affected and where modifier indicator status has changed.
